Mine Hill’s K-12 students are served by two school districts:

K-6 students attend the award-winning Canfield Avenue School (CAS), which is run by the Mine Hill Board of Education.  CAS is a past winner of the National School of Excellence Award, and continues to be a school choice option for students from any district in NJ.  Click here to visit the Canfield School’s website.

Mine Hill students in grades 7-12 are served by the Dover School System.  7th and 8th Graders attend Dover Middle School; 9th through 12th Graders attend Dover High School.

The Dover School district is vastly underrated.  Dover High School has been awarded the US News & World Reports Silver Medal for continued positive progress in testing.  It is one of three high schools in Morris County to win this prestigious award.  Dover High School also has an alliance with the NJ Institute of Technology.  This alliance will enable our students to earn up to 28 college credits prior to graduation from Dover High School.

School Choice Options:

Morris County promotes school choice options through the State of NJ’s school choice law. Numerous school districts in Morris County offer school choice options for students K-12.
